So I got fitted by D'ornellas bike shop in Scarborough (Warden and Lawrence area). The owner (Eon) did the fitting, he used to be cycling champ in the 70s and 80s, he's from Guyana. It took about an 1 1/2 hours, but we were shooting the shit too. I never knew a fitting was that detailed. Everyting from seat height, seat position, bar height and extension, to the angle. I even needed extensions for the pedals, because I could clearly see that my knees were going out when he used a laser to show me. I just wasn't putting down power in a vertical plane.
Then the guy went for a ride a with me to ensure that everything was good. He gave me some pointers on proper form, and even pointed me to some good online resources for learning proper technique etc. Great experience dealing with them
